Located at a higher altitude atop Danche, the station's name comes from a landmark giant Warka banyan tree within its grounds. Warka banyan trees typically grow at altitudes of 1400-2500 meters, precisely in the high-altitude coffee-growing regions of Yirgacheffe, Guji, and Haru. With their straight, massive trunks, extremely wide canopies, and smooth, grey-white bark, they are iconic trees at the coffee processing plant, providing natural shade for the coffee drying beds and contributing unique and excellent flavors. Locals consider them sacred trees and never cut them down.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eNegusse Debela sources coffee from hundreds of smallholder farmers in the surrounding area.
